0

ある html ファイルを別の html ファイルに含めようとしています。MAMPスタックでコーディングしています。SSI は自動的に許可されると思います。1 つの html ファイルの本文を入力 <!--#include virtual="header.html" --> します。もう 1 つのファイルは header.html と呼ばれ、両方とも同じフォルダーにあります。代わりに、ファイル header.shtml を呼び出してみました。これはどれも機能しません。イライラします。

コードは含まれていません。フォームとナビゲーション バーを含めていますが、表示されません。

4

1 に答える 1

1

SSIは自動的に許可されると思います

それは非常に大きな仮定です。SSI は、mod_include がロードされている場合にのみ機能します。関連ファイルのフィルターを有効にする必要もあります。

AddOutputFilter INCLUDES .shtml

...そしてもちろん、インクルードが構成内の他の場所でオーバーライドされないようにしてください。

これを読みましたか?

于 2010-09-15T13:48:01.307 に答える